div#toppanel.cloned header div.logo img {
    max-width: 90px;
    max-height: 80px;
}
.padtop.tnmtdivisions {
    display: none;
}

.contactform {
    display: none;
}

div#toppanel {
        box-shadow: 0px 4px 20px #1e631d;
}


img.homeobximage {
    max-width: 253px;
    max-height: 177px;
}

.homeboxtitle {
	margin-bottom:0px;
}

.boxheader {
    background-color:#48a847;
}

div#toppanel.cloned nav.mainnav {
    margin: 0px auto 0 auto;
}


nav.mainnav li a:hover
{
    color: #599864;
    background-color: #f1eded;

}

nav.mainnav ul.sublevel li a {
    background-color: #f1eded;
}

nav.mainnav ul.sublevel li a:hover {
    background-color: lightgray;
}


@media screen and (max-width: 760px) {
    header div.logo img {
        max-width: 120px;
        max-height: 80px;
    }
    nav.mainnav ul.sublevel li a {
        background-color: #c8d7fb;
    }
}